Najib: Six Umno divisions can spearhead recapture of Kedah


(The Star) – Prime Minister Datuk Seri Najib Tun Razak wants the six Umno divisions in southern Kedah to be the catalyst for Barisan Nasional’s victory in the general election.

He said the divisions of Baling, Merbok, Sik, Sungai Petani, Padang Serai as well as Kulim-Bandar Baharu formed the backbone of the party in the state.

“I chose to visit southern Kedah because this region has been our fort all this while.

“As Baling had played an important role in our country’s history, then let the voice of Baling be etched in the history of Umno and Barisan Nasional in our struggle to return Kedah back to Barisan,” he said when opening the Umno delegates conference for the six divisions here on Thursday.

He said other areas such as Alor Setar and Jerlun were equally important, stressing that the divisions should work together and fight hard to win back Kedah.

He said party members should have resolved all internal problems that by now.

“Enough is enough. It has been over four years since the last general election and they should stop pointing fingers at each other.

“We, at the top leadership, have spoken about this issue countless times and now its time for the members to fulfill their pledges of loyalty to the party.

“Let us not merely look at what the (Barisan) government had promised to do for us, but rather what we can do for the government,” he said.

The premier stressed that if all Umno members and fellow Barisan component party members voted for Barisan’s candidates in Kedah, there was no reason why the party could not win in the state.

He said party members should understand the meaning of unity and loyalty as well as put the party’s interests above all else, including personal interests.

“Umno is 66 years old while the nation will be celebrating 55 years of Independence.

“People say we should be matured as a party by now, with a lifetime of experiences.

“But, we need to further explore the knowledge of rational thinking to make wise and acceptable decisions.

“That is what maturity should mean, where leaders know the true meaning of unity and loyalty, not merely by the party’s age,” he said.

Najib advised Kedah Umno members to take the party’s defeat in the last general election as a valuable lesson to do better this time.

He said with an oath of loyalty that was earlier taken by Umno leaders from all six divisions in southern Kedah, led by Baling Umno division chief Datuk Abdul Azeez Abdul Rahim earlier, he was confident southern Kedah would return to Barisan.
